Lid ScrewsUse Allen key to remove lid screws and access the interior of the PowerSyncTM enclosure.

PlugRemove one plug for each required cable entry and replace with suitable cable gland or conduit adaptor.

Mounting HolesUse suitable screws (6 mm or 1/4” diameter) and flat washers to attach enclosure to suitable mounting surface.

Observe orientation diagram in back of enclosure for correct orientation. Enclosure should be mounted in a vertical orientation so that the cable entries do not face upwards.

PlugLeave plug in place if not required for cable entry.

SealIf required, retain and use seal provided to ensure a water tight seal between cable, gland and enclosure

Electronic Equipment inside; failing to seal enclosure properly will void warranty.

Installation of DMX wires

Wire clamp

Gently lift wire clamp to the open position. Do not force beyond this point.

Insertion points

Each wire clamp has two insertion points. Insert each wire as per appropriate wiring diagram.

Insert wire

Push the wire all the way into the insertion point. If done correctly, the end of the wire will be visible through the opening in the wire clamp.

The wire insulation should not be removed before wire insertion.

Close wire clamp

Firmly press the wire clamp back into its closed position; clamping the wires in place.

The wire clamp will cut the insulation and make contact.

Up to 45 luminaires per run under the following conditions: Max total cable run length 150m (492') in up to two trunk cables

Refer to 'Maximum Circuit Load' table for circuit limitations

Always observe local electrical codes for branch circuit current limitations

For run length in excess of 30m (100') use a wire size not lower than 14 AWG

Terminator

Use PowerSync™ terminator, supplied with leader cable to terminate last luminaire in chain.

T

Maximum Current

≤16.0A through LS6540 Data Injector.

I

Connection Type

Circuits can be configured as either connectorised or hardwired. For details consult installation instructions and comply with local electrical codes.

NOTE: The above diagrams are intended to show electrical pathways between luminaires and ancillary device. These diagrams are not intended to show typeor colour of cord / wire, luminaire input voltage rating, wire gauge or approved use of the cord / wire supplied with luminaires.

Maximum trunk cable length 150 m/490ft*

Maximum fixture count per PowerSyncTM Injector 45*

Maximum branch circuits fed from 1 PowerSyncTM Injector 2

Maximum cable length for a 2-branch circuit 75 m/245ft*

Maximum circuit current 16A (Linear luminaires, connectorized, limited to 12.8A)

Maximum and Minimum System Voltage 120-277 V AC

Maximum leader cable length No limit (within trunk cable limits)

Circuits must be terminated at the furthest point from the PowerSyncTM Injector.

*Dependant on circuit load and voltage drop

PowerSyncTM System Limitations
